Integrated Scale
The new Toyota legal-for-trade integrated scale allows operators to simultaneously weigh and transport loads. This results in reduced logistics costs and increased effectiveness. Toyota has developed an industry exclusive scale-mounted fork positioner alternative which allows operators to accurately and quickly position the forks without having to leave their seat.
AGVs or Automated Guided Vehicles
AGVs offer clients many different benefits, including: higher overall productivity, continuous operation, reduced product damage and improved process flow. These kinds of vehicles are also known for reducing non-value-added activity and improving process flow.
